Background: gammaoryzanol is a natural antioxidant and could provide beneficial asused in the food products due to the antioxidant activity and potential health benefits.nanotechnology has been introduced into several aspects of the food science,including encapsulation of materials and used as delivery systems. the field ofnanoparticle delivery systems for nutrients and nutraceuticals has been expanding overthe last decades. purpose: the aim of this work was evaluation of different methodsfor preparation of polymeric nanoparticle containing gammaoryzanol. methods:nanoprecipitation technique, where polymer and gammaoryzanol were dissolved inacetone, nano-emulsion template method, by stepwise addition of water in to the oilphase consisting of ethyl acetate, gammaoryzanol and surfactant mixtures, as well asemulsification solvent evaporation technique, where gammaoryzanol and polymerwere dissolved in ethyl acetate and chloroform, were used for preparation ofnanoparticles. two ratio of gammaoryzanol-polymer (ethyl cellulose) (1:2 and 1:4) aswell as different solvents and surfactants were used in these methods to producegammaoryzanol nanoparticles. results: among these methods, solvent evaporationtechnique has been successfully employed to produce gammaoryzanol loadednanoparticles with desired characteristics.
